Jan 6, 2026 at 2:02 PMLiege Airport has announced the introduction of a new regular cargo flight connection with Chongqing. Starting January 5, 2024, Suparna Airlines will operate regular flights between Chongqing Jiangbei International Airport and Liege Airport. This connection represents the first direct air freight link between these two locations and significantly expands the cargo network of Liege Airport.
Strategic Importance of the New Connection
Chongqing is considered one of the most significant industrial, logistics, and e-commerce centers in China and plays a crucial role in global supply chains. The new connection will support the transport of e-commerce goods, high-tech products, automotive components, and industrial goods. This provides shippers with a fast and reliable solution for the movement of goods between Western China and the European market.
Torsten, Vice President of Sales and Marketing at Liege Airport, commented on the new connection: “We are pleased to welcome Suparna Airlines to Liege Airport and to launch our first direct regular connection with Chongqing. Chongqing is an important new addition to our network and further confirms Liege’s role as a trusted and efficient gateway between China and Europe.”
A representative from the management of Chongqing Airport added: “The introduction of this direct regular service to Liege is an important step in expanding Chongqing’s international cargo network. This new connection strengthens trade relations with Europe and highlights Chongqing’s role as a central logistics hub in Western China.”
With this new regular connection, Liege Airport continues its efforts to expand the Asian cargo network and strengthen long-term partnerships with international cargo airlines. This is in line with the changing demands of global logistics and cross-border trade.
